Abstract

Mass density spatial distributions of selected gas-puff targets have been determined by radiography, using quasi-monochromatic radiation at a wavelength of 13 nm. Results of spatial distributions of mass densities at various initial reservoir pressures for Nitrogen, Argon and Krypton targets are presented. Changes in the mass density spatial distribution due to a nozzle wear are reported.
